There are 2 options to travel between Portsmouth and Newbury including taking a train and bus.
The cheapest way to travel from Portsmouth to Newbury is a bus with an average price of $34.

This is compared to other travel options from Portsmouth to Newbury:

A bus is $6 less than a train for this route with tickets for a train from Portsmouth to Newbury costing on average $40.

The fastest way to travel from Portsmouth to Newbury is by train with an average journey time of 2h 39m.

Other travel options to Newbury take longer:

Bus takes on average 8h 15m.

The distance from Portsmouth to Newbury is approximately 42 miles (69 km).
The average frequency per day from Portsmouth to Newbury is:
  • Around 5 trains per day.
  • Around 1 buses per day.

However, we recommend checking specific travel dates for your route between Portsmouth and Newbury as scheduled services by train and bus can vary by season or day of the week.

These are the most popular departure and arrival points from Portsmouth to Newbury:
  • Trains mostly depart from Portsmouth & Southsea (PMS) and arrive in Newbury station (NBY).
